在PowerShell中,touch命令是一个非常有用的命令,主要用于创建文件。虽然它的名字让人联想到Unix系统中的touch命令,但在PowerShell中,它的功能更加丰富。本文将详细解释PowerShell中的touch命令,并提供一些实际应用案例。
PowerShell中的touch命令概述
touch命令在PowerShell中用于创建文件。如果你需要创建一个空的文件,而不想使用New-Item命令,那么touch命令是一个很好的选择。此外,touch命令还可以用来修改文件的时间戳。
基本语法
touch [Path]
其中,Path是要创建的文件的路径。
参数说明
[Path]:指定要创建的文件的路径。
touch命令的实际应用案例
1. 创建一个空文件
假设你想要在当前目录下创建一个名为example.txt的空文件,可以使用以下命令:
touch example.txt
执行此命令后,PowerShell会在当前目录下创建一个名为example.txt的空文件。
2. 创建文件并设置时间戳
touch命令还可以用来修改文件的时间戳。以下命令将创建一个名为example.txt的文件,并将其创建时间设置为当前时间:
touch -creation example.txt
执行此命令后,example.txt文件将被创建,并且其创建时间将被设置为当前时间。
3. 创建多个文件
如果你想同时创建多个文件,可以使用通配符。以下命令将在当前目录下创建所有以.txt结尾的文件:
touch *.txt
执行此命令后,PowerShell会在当前目录下创建所有以.txt结尾的文件。
4. 创建文件并指定权限
以下命令将在当前目录下创建一个名为example.txt的文件,并将其权限设置为“只读”:
touch example.txt -attributes readonly
执行此命令后,example.txt文件将被创建,并且其权限将被设置为“只读”。
总结
touch命令在PowerShell中是一个非常实用的命令,可以用来创建文件和修改文件的时间戳。通过本文的介绍,相信你已经对PowerShell中的touch命令有了更深入的了解。在实际应用中,你可以根据需要灵活使用这个命令。